1.Neurologic Manifestations according to Serotypes of Enterovirus in Pediatric Inpatient in Incheon.
Keun Young KIM ; Ji Sun PARK ; Mun Ju KWON ; Kyung Seon KIM ; Young Se KWON
Journal of the Korean Child Neurology Society 2017;25(4):255-260
PURPOSE: Enterovirus infection in children can manifest various disease and enterovirus have many serotypes. This study was aimed to investigate neurologic manifestations according to serotypes of enterovirus in pediatric inpatients in Incheon. METHODS: We collected the stool samples from the admitted pediatric patients in Inha University Hospital from January 2015 to September 2016. Enterovirus detection and serotypes identification were performed by real-time reverse transcriptase polymerase chain reaction (RT-PCR) and semi-nested RT-PCR. RESULTS: A total of 527 samples were collected during study period and 170 patients (32.2%) were diagnosed with enterovirus infections. Genetic sequences of enteroviruses were identified: echovirus 18 (50, 40.5%), enterovirus 71 (12, 9.6%), coxakievirus A10 (10, 8.0%), echovirus 6 (7, 5.6%). Virus in patient with meningitis were identified: echovirus 18 (15, 75%), coxakievirus B5 (2, 10%), enterovirus 71 (2, 10%), and echovirus 6 (1, 5%). Neurologic manifestations of echovirus 18 are headache (15, 30%), vomiting (17, 34%), meningeal irritation sign (10, 20.0%). And enterovirus 71 have headache (3, 25%), vomiting (3, 25%), meningeal irritation sign (2, 16.0%), seizure (1, 8.3%), neurologic sequelae (1, 8.3%). Echovirus 18 and neurologic manifestation have a statistically significant correlation with other serotypes (r=0.701, P < 0.01) CONCLUSION: Echovirus 18 infection was more prominent in neurological symptoms than in other serotypes. The major serotype of meningitis was echovirus 18 but there was no reported neurologic sequelae. Enterovirus infection has different neurological symptoms, depending on the serotypes.

2.Frequency of Pro475Ser Polymorphism of ADAMTS13 Gene and Its Association with ADAMTS-13 Activity in the Korean Population.
Mun Ju JANG ; Nam Keun KIM ; So Young CHONG ; Hye Jin KIM ; Seon Ju LEE ; Myung Seo KANG ; Doyeun OH
Yonsei Medical Journal 2008;49(3):405-408
PURPOSE: The in vitro study suggested that proline to serine polymorphism in codon 475 (C1423T) of the A Disintegrin and Metalloprotease with ThromboSpondin type 1 repeats-13 (ADAMTS-13) gene is related to reduced activity of ADAMTS- 13. In this study, the frequency of the Pro475Ser polymorphism in Koreans was studied and plasma ADAMTS-13 activity was measured to find out whether this polymorphism contributes to decreased ADAMTS-13 activity in Koreans. PATIENTS AND METHODS: The frequency of the C1423T allele of the ADAMTS13 gene was studied along with measuring plasma ADAMTS-13 activity in 250 healthy Korean individuals. RESULTS: The allele frequency of C1423T polymorphism was 4%, and the median activity of CT type was 107 (69-143)%, which was lower than in controls with the CC genotype [118 (48-197)%, (p=0.021)]. CONCLUSION: Therefore, the Pro475Ser polymorphism seems to be popular in the Korean population, and attenuates ADAMTS-13 plasma activity.

3.Guidelines for Manufacturing and Application of Organoids: Liver
Hye-Ran MOON ; Seon Ju MUN ; Tae Hun KIM ; Hyemin KIM ; Dukjin KANG ; Suran KIM ; Ji Hyun SHIN ; Dongho CHOI ; Sun-Ju AHN ; Myung Jin SON
International Journal of Stem Cells 2024;17(2):120-129
Recent amendments to regulatory frameworks have placed a greater emphasis on the utilization of in vitro testing platforms for preclinical drug evaluations and toxicity assessments. This requires advanced tissue models capable of accurately replicating liver functions for drug efficacy and toxicity predictions. Liver organoids, derived from human cell sources, offer promise as a reliable platform for drug evaluation. However, there is a lack of standardized quality evaluation methods, which hinders their regulatory acceptance. This paper proposes comprehensive quality standards tailored for liver organoids, addressing cell source validation, organoid generation, and functional assessment. These guidelines aim to enhance reproducibility and accuracy in toxicity testing, thereby accelerating the adoption of organoids as a reliable alternative or complementary tool to animal testing in drug development. The quality standards include criteria for size, cellular composition, gene expression, and functional assays, thus ensuring a robust hepatotoxicity testing platform.
4.Upregulation of mitochondrial NAD⁺ levels impairs the clonogenicity of SSEA1⁺ glioblastoma tumor-initiating cells.
Myung Jin SON ; Jae Sung RYU ; Jae Yun KIM ; Youjeong KWON ; Kyung Sook CHUNG ; Seon Ju MUN ; Yee Sook CHO
Experimental & Molecular Medicine 2017;49(6):e344-
Emerging evidence has emphasized the importance of cancer therapies targeting an abnormal metabolic state of tumor-initiating cells (TICs) in which they retain stem cell-like phenotypes and nicotinamide adenine dinucleotide (NAD⁺) metabolism. However, the functional role of NAD⁺ metabolism in regulating the characteristics of TICs is not known. In this study, we provide evidence that the mitochondrial NAD⁺ levels affect the characteristics of glioma-driven SSEA1⁺ TICs, including clonogenic growth potential. An increase in the mitochondrial NAD⁺ levels by the overexpression of the mitochondrial enzyme nicotinamide nucleotide transhydrogenase (NNT) significantly suppressed the sphere-forming ability and induced differentiation of TICs, suggesting a loss of the characteristics of TICs. In addition, increased SIRT3 activity and reduced lactate production, which are mainly observed in healthy and young cells, appeared following NNT-overexpressed TICs. Moreover, in vivo tumorigenic potential was substantially abolished by NNT overexpression. Conversely, the short interfering RNA-mediated knockdown of NNT facilitated the maintenance of TIC characteristics, as evidenced by the increased numbers of large tumor spheres and in vivo tumorigenic potential. Our results demonstrated that targeting the maintenance of healthy mitochondria with increased mitochondrial NAD⁺ levels and SIRT3 activity could be a promising strategy for abolishing the development of TICs as a new therapeutic approach to treating aging-associated tumors.

5.Usefulness of Verbal Fluency Performance as Follow-up Screening Tool in Patients With Mild to Moderate Alzheimer's Disease.
Ju Hui LEE ; Kyung Hun KANG ; Ho Wan KWAK ; Mun Seon CHANG ; Dai Seg BAI ; Sung Pa PARK ; Ho Won LEE
Journal of the Korean Neurological Association 2011;29(2):106-111
BACKGROUND: Impaired verbal fluency in Alzheimer's disease (AD) has been well documented. Furthermore, crosssectional studies suggest that semantic fluency is disproportionately impaired relative to phonemic fluency in AD. The aim of this study was to determine the ability of fluency measures as follow-up screening tool for mild to moderate AD. METHODS: Participants were recruited from AD patients in mild to moderate stages. We annually evaluated semantic (animal, supermarket) and phonemic (giyeok, siot, ieung) fluency and tested other extensive neuropsychological measures for two years. RESULTS: A total of 33 AD patients were included at baseline and 1-year follow-up, who were aged 70.18+/-5.97 years at baseline. Eleven patients completed a 2-year follow-up. Phonemic fluency total score was not significantly changed during the study period. However, semantic fluency total score tended to decline annually, and significantly declined at 2-year follow-up compared to baseline. In addition, difference score (semantic fluency minus phonemic fluency) was significantly decreased at every follow-up compared to previous year. In Pearson correlation analyses between changes of verbal fluency and other neuropsychological measures, changes of semantic fluency appeared to be significantly correlated with neuropsychological measures much more than changes of phonemic fluency. CONCLUSIONS: Significant longitudinal declines in semantic fluency compared to phonemic fluency seem to be consistent with previous cross-sectional studies. These patterns of changes in verbal fluency were observed even at an interval of one year follow-up in our study. The verbal fluency might be useful follow-up screening test for mild to moderate AD in the memory clinic setting.

6.Epidemiology and Clinical manifestations of Enterovirus in Pediatric Inpatient in Incheon.
Byoung Wook CHO ; Seong Eun KWON ; Mun Ju KWON ; Myong Je HUR ; Kyung Seon KIM ; Young Jin HONG ; Soon Ki KIM ; Young Se KWON ; Dong Hyun KIM
Pediatric Infection & Vaccine 2016;23(1):46-53
PURPOSE: Enterovirus (EV) infection in children can manifest various diseases from asymptomatic infection to nonspecific febrile illness, hand-foot-mouth disease, and aseptic meningitis. This study was aimed to investigate epidemiology and clinical significance of various genotypes of EV infections in pediatric inpatient. METHODS: We collected the stool samples from the admitted pediatric patients in Inha University Hospital from March 2014 to March 2015. EV detection and genotype identification were performed by real-time RT-PCR and semi-nested RT-PCR. Phylogenetic trees were constructed by neighbor joining method. RESULTS: A total of 400 samples were collected during study period and 112 patients (28%) were diagnosed with EV infections. The mean age of EV positive patients was 2.66 years (0.1-14) and sex ratio was 1.73:1. Genetic sequences of EVs were identified; coxsackievirus B5 (17, 15.2%), coxsackievirus A16 (13, 11.6%), enterovirus 71 (10, 8.9%), and coxsackievirus A2 (9, 8.0%). Nonspecific febrile illness (96, 86%) was the most common clinical manifestation and the duration of fever was 0-11 days (mean 3.1 days). Rash (44, 39%) and meningitis (43, 38%) were followed. Patients who were attending daycare center or had siblings accounted for 82.1%. Phylogenetic relationship tree revealed 6 distinct genogroups among 56 types of EVs. CONCLUSIONS: This study is the report of epidemiology, serotype distribution and clinical manifestations of children with EV infection in Incheon. This data will be helpful for further study about the epidemiology of EV infection in Korea.

7.A Case of Diabetic Gastroparesis Presenting as Acute Gastric Dilatation.
Ji Han PARK ; Sung Pyo HONG ; Mun Ju JANG ; Esther KIM ; Il CHOI ; Seon Young KWAK ; Kwang Hyun KO ; Seong Gyu HWANG ; Pil Won PARK
Korean Journal of Gastrointestinal Motility 2003;9(1):62-65
Diabetic gastroparesis is a pathologic condition of delayed gastric emptying with gastrointestinal symptoms such as nausea, early satiety and vomiting in the absence of mechanical obstruction in patients with diabetes mellitus. We report a case of diabetic gastroparesis who had diabetes mellitus for 13 years and suffered from nausea and vomiting with marked gastric dilatation of acute onset. Blood glucose level of the patient was very high and any mechanical obstruction was not found by gastroduodenal endoscopy, hypotonic duodenography, celiac angiography, electrogastrography and CT scan. Acute gastric dilatation was resolved with conservative treatment of gastric drainage, glucose control and hydration. Gastrointestinal symptoms of nausea and vomiting improved and diet was well tolerated thereafter.

8.The Effect of Marital Satisfaction and Dysfunctional Attitudes on Married Women's Depression.
Eun Kyoung KIM ; Ho Taek YI ; Ju Hee PAIK ; Sang Yeon LEE ; Jong Mun HONG ; Jae Weon LEE ; Seon Moo KIM ; Tong Wook HUH
Journal of Korean Neuropsychiatric Association 1999;38(4):702-712
OBJECTIVES: This study was designed to examine the effect of marital satisfaction and dysfunctional attitudes on depression in married women. METHODS: Forty depressed married female patients and 34 non-depressed married women as normal control group completed three self-report questionnaires, Beck Depression Inventory(BDI) Dysfunctional Attitude Scale(DAS) and Dyadic Adjustment Scale(DYAS) Marital satisfaction and dysfunctional attitudes were compared by student t-test between the two groups. Also, relative importances of each variables to depression were examined with stepwise multiple regression analysis. RESULTS: Depressed patients reported significantly lower level of marital satisfaction and showed higher level of dysfunctional attitudes than normal controls. Dyadic satisfaction, approval need, and perfectionism subfactors were more important in predicting depressive symptomatology than other variables in patients. CONCLUSION: We conclude that marital satisfaction has significant influence on development and maintenance of depression in married women, and in underlying thinking process, dysfunctional attitudes serve as a cognitive vulnerability factor. This conclusion involves the expectation that if dysfunctional attitudes of depressed married women could be changed positively, their marital satisfaction will be increased to higher level and depression will be decreased. Overall, our findings stress that we need to consider the degrees of marital satisfaction and dysfunctional attitudes of depressed maried women, when treating them, in order to individualize treatments and optimize our ability to predict responsiveness to therapy.

9.Long-Term Expansion of Functional Human Pluripotent Stem Cell-Derived Hepatic Organoids
Seon Ju MUN ; Yeon-Hwa HONG ; Hyo-Suk AHN ; Jae-Sung RYU ; Kyung-Sook CHUNG ; Myung Jin SON
International Journal of Stem Cells 2020;13(2):279-286
A human cell-based liver model capable of long-term expansion and mature hepatic function is a fundamental requirement for pre-clinical drug development. We previously established self-renewing and functionally mature human pluripotent stem cell-derived liver organoids as an alternate to primary human hepatocytes. In this study, we tested long-term prolonged culture of organoids to increase their maturity. Organoid growing at the edge of Matrigel started to deteriorate two weeks after culturing, and the expression levels of the functional mature hepatocyte marker ALB were decreased at four weeks of culture. Replating the organoids weekly at a 1:2 ratio in fresh Matrigel, resulted in healthier morphology with a thicker layer compared to organoids maintained on the same Matrigel and significantly increased ALB expression until three weeks, although, it decreased sharply at four weeks. The levels of the fetal hepatocyte marker AFP were considerably increased in long-term cultures of organoids. Therefore, we performed serial passaging of organoids, whereby they were mechanically split weekly at a 1:3∼1:5 ratio in fresh Matrigel. The organoids expanded so far over passage 55, or 1 year, without growth retardation and maintained a normal karyotype after long-term cryopreservation. Differentiation potentials were maintained or increased after long-term passaging, while AFP expression considerably decreased after passaging. Therefore, these data demonstrate that organoids can be exponentially expanded by serial passaging, while maintaining long-term functional maturation potential. Thus, hepatic organoids can be a practical and renewable cell source for human cell-based and personalized 3D liver models.
10.The prevalence and clinical significance of transitional vertebrae: a radiologic investigation using whole spine spiral three-dimensional computed tomographic images
A Ram DOO ; Jeongwoo LEE ; Gwi Eun YEO ; Keun Hyeong LEE ; Ye Sull KIM ; Ju Han MUN ; Young Jin HAN ; Ji-Seon SON
Anesthesia and Pain Medicine 2020;15(1):103-110
Background:
Errors in counting spinal segments are common during interventional procedures when there are transitional vertebrae. In this study, we investigated the prevalence of the transitional vertebrae including thoracolumbar transitional vertebra (TLTV) and lumbosacral transitional vertebrae (LSTV). The relationship between the existence of TLTV and abnormal rib count or the existence of LSTV were also evaluated.
Methods:
The vertebral levels were counted craniocaudally, starting from C1, based on the assumption of 7 cervical, 12 thoracic, and 5 lumbar vertebrae, using whole spine spiral three-dimensional computed tomographic images. The 20th and 25th vertebrae were defined as L1 and S1, respectively.
Results:
In total, 150 patients had TLTV, with a prevalence of 11.2% (150/1,340). LSTV was observed in 111 of 1,340 cases (8.3%). Sacralization was observed in 68 of 1,340 cases (5.1%) and lumbarization in 43 of 1,340 cases (3.2%). There was a significant relationship between the existence of TLTV and the abnormal rib count (odds ratio [OR]: 117.26, 95% confidence interval [95% CI]: 60.77–226.27; P < 0.001) and LSTV (OR: 7.38, 95% CI: 3.99–13.63; P < 0.001).
Conclusions
Our study results suggest that patients with TLTV are more likely to have an abnormal rib count or LSTV. If a TLTV or LSTV is seen on the fluoroscopic image, a whole spine image is necessary to permit accurate numbering of the lumbar vertebra.
